A Shot of Both of the Lights in my Yard
Here you can see the M-250R in the foreground with the browned out lens I stuck in it (I have the original glass for it though) and the OV-10IB on the brand-new light pole on the shed. I haven't lit both together since it takes like three or four cords to give power to both. I plan on rewiring the set-up in the foreground with UF cable and run it to a box and then have the cord go to a box and have a cord go from that like the new set-up but I got to save up some cash for that...
